Account Recovery — Pagewright Static Builds

If a customer loses access to their Pagewright dashboard, incremental rebuilds of their static site will continue from the last known-good deploy, so no content is lost during recovery. Confirm the customer's last rebuild timestamp in the Orlin console, then initiate the recovery flow from the admin panel. Do not trigger a full rebuild until access is restored. Unlocking the recovery flow requires the passphrase below.

recovery phrase for yadup-taguf: wenael-quenox-kelix

## Releases

Pledgerly report exports store timestamps in UTC; the Quartzline renderer converts to the workspace timezone at download. Never bake local offsets into the export job. DST edge cases are covered in tests/tz_matrix. Cut releases from main, bump the version in exporter.toml, and run make release-check. CI at Hollowgate signs the bundle automatically. If signing manually, use the deploy key below.

signing key of fajop-tahop = bky9_qdL6xeDv7

Subject: Spoolwright service handoff details

Hi team — documenting this carefully for whoever maintains the Farrow integration next. The Spoolwright printer-spooler microservice queues jobs per tenant and retries transient failures up to three times with exponential backoff. All partner calls must include authentication on every request, even health probes, or the gateway silently drops them. For your sandbox testing, please use the bearer token that follows.

session JWT of yawep-yawep = eyJhbGciOiJIUzI1NiIsInR5cCI6IkpXVCJ9.eyJzdWIiOiI3pWF3_In0.aXYsHiog